We need arrows on the HUD to indicate the position of nearby cars since in cockpit and bonnet views we have huge blind spots. Maybe they could start to fade in as cars come within a certain range and get more opaque as cars get closer. Players would need an option to disable this.
-
Players often dislike how short races are in recent games, but if they were longer then others would complain that theyāre too long. Give us an option to scale race distances, with winnings adjusted accordingly. If I run a ten-lap race, maybe it would be worth five times the EXP and CR of the same race someone else did on just two laps. This way, everyone gets the experience they want and everyone is happy. This is regarding career mode, of course, since we can already choose race distance in free play.

For FM6 I think it would be neat if we had teammates. It might be a neat mechanic for career, but multiplayer got me thinking of this. I was playing in public lobbies with a friend the other night and thought it would be neat if we were teammates.
I donāt expect it to be mandatory that players have teammates, or for there to be modes dedicated to having teammates, but rather just have it as a bonus option in normal multiplayer. We could still run solo or partner up with another player as a two-person team.
It would be neat if combined with a return of car clubs. In FM4 we could have cars shared in a club garage, but maybe this time we could also have club liveries and tuning setups shared with just our club. That way, my friend and I could run the same car with matching team liveries, but not necessarily the same setup if we donāt want the same upgrades or tuning setup. If club-mates arenāt online to join us as teammates, we could simply pair up with someone in our lobby or invite one in.
At the end of a race we still get results with who finished in what position and get our EXP and CR accordingly, but next to that could be a list of team results, with highest combined results to the lowest. I figured teams would earn some bonus EXP and CR based on where their team finished, though the rewards should be lower than what we get for our usual finish so as to not be overly unfair to players running solo and not to detract from the value of a good personal result. Maybe, for example, a team finishing on top might get winnings equal to 25% of what we get for earning gold in a race.
We need a way to choose teammates rather than it just being random, but I donāt want everyone swamped with requests. I thought we might be prompted to pick people we want paired with. It lists the players in the lobby and I pick who I most want, then second, third, et cetera, and they do the same. Players get paired off with the players with the most mutual interest. If we donāt want a teammate, we donāt pick anyone. If nobody wants us, weāre on our own.
I thought this might add a co-op dynamic, and it might also encourage players to be more sporting because few will want to team up with someone who clowns around. Maybe my teammate is up ahead on the Nordschleife and he warns me of a bad wreck just over the hill or weāre on an oval coordinating as drafting buddies. Maybe someone is being unsporting and I warn my trailing teammate to watch out for him. If we also awarded a bonus for a teammate being in our car club, that might encourage players to coax their friends into playing more, which might promote more online play for a larger online community and more activity.

I would love to see an expansion of how new cars are purchased. Something to the tune of how the original Test Drive Unlimited operated.
In essence what I would like to see is a dealer options list.
For example:
I want to buy a Mustang, so I go to the Ford dealer section of ābuy carsā and select the Mustang.
The mustang pops up in its most basic form (V6 manual hardtop)
I can then select options, trim packages, colors, and even pick out performance variations of the car (Saleen, Shelby, Rousch, etc.)
This is similar to how a ābuild your carā section of a car manufacturers website would operate. Obviously picking trim pieces and convertible tops and sound systems is superfluous to a racing sim, but it would increase the level of immersion and realism and give users true customization and almost limitless opportunities when building and pricing new cars.
You can even show lineage and evolution of a car using this system as well. For instance when the Mustang is selected all available model years in their most basic forms would show up (from 1964.5 all the way to 2015) and the players can select which year they want and build from the starter Mustang.
However the most important part of this is building up the car from the base model (performance wise). It gives Forza and Turn10 the opportunity to vastly increase the available array of cars and engines without having to model fifteen different kinds of Mustangs (and sell them side by side) and it would be amazing to have all these options available to us players.
This system will allow Turn10 to maintain the excellent job they do of providing the lineage and history of the cars in the lineup (best represented in Forza 4 by BMW M3, M5, Ford Mustang and Chevrolet Corvette) but also provide all different options and performance ranges of the cars like it was and is available in real life.
This is not something that can be implemented in Forza 5 but this could be the evolution that brings Forza way out ahead of the pack of available sim racers, especially after Project CARS enters the scene and starts chewing at GT and Forzaās market share.
